Is it possible to automatically backup certain folder the same way RAID 1 or 0 (the one for backup) does. I mean, I have my main 40gb HDD and can I use a smaller old HDD to backup whatever is saved in certain important folders ?
Of course I can do this manually, but human brain being what it is, it will most likely end up being forgotten and/or just let aside. So, is there a way to do that, if so, how ?
